That looks like an RV type trailer frame.  Zieman?  Do you know the GVW?  If you say those axles are 2700# (unless I misread) the GVW may be only like 5500-5800#.  If it is, then you will most likely be over weight with two rigs on it. I hope I'm wrong.  The GVW might be stamped in the frame somewhere near or on the tongue possibly or even have a data plate riveted to it somewhere.

I just would h8 to see you do something like this and then get all bummed because you find out it wasn't safe, that's all.  Otherwise a good project! If at the very least it will fit one truck and lotsa other stuff.  :yupyup:  :gap:
